Establishes a cap on the reduction of State school aid for New Jersey school districts.
The bill establishes a cap on the reduction of State school aid for New Jersey school districts, ensuring that no district receives a reduction in State school aid greater than five percent of the district’s net budget for the prior year. The cap applies to equalization aid, special education categorical aid, security aid, and transportation aid. The bill also outlines specific conditions under which certain districts may be exempt from reductions in State aid. The cap is set to take effect immediately upon enactment.
